[PSES] D of C and product safety warnings and caution markings
I have a question that has been presented to me for several years now and I need this groups help. When we ship our products to the end user and our products meets all of the LVD requirements (per IEC/EN 60950), we place a physical copy of our D of C with EACH terminal. I have been ask if we could put our D of C on our company web site and make reference, physically on the shipping box to the web address where our D of C would be posted. The issue I need help with is this. does the D of C have to be shipped physically with EACH product in the shipping box OR can the shipping box have a web address printed on it to direct the end user to our D of C? Also, if the D of C is NOT physically in the shipping box, how does the country customs inspector know if we meet the required EU LVD requirements? RE: Current from Car 12V cigarette lighter socket
Yes Charles it's UL 2089 Vehicle Battery Adapters. I also have a unit (ITE Listed) that will operate from a auto battery and I have to make sure that all my 12V devices meets this standard.
